After a terrific visit, I've decided to accept the Master's offer at IU-Bloomington. Future applicants reading this thread, feel free to get in touch with me if you have any questions about the program. (And keep in mind that everyone, Master's and PhDs alike, gets full tuition waivers and stipends in exchange for teaching, which was a big plus for me.) I also turned down NYU, USC, and Florida today, so I hope that helps anyone waiting for any of those.

I'm also vacillating, and I found it pretty helpful to look at previous course directories, and see the classes that were recently offered at both programs. (You can take into account things like the breadth of choices, the overall focus, the gaps and omissions...) It may give you a more tangible sense of what your academic future might look like.
